Peaches and Cream Pull Apart Bread Recipe
This Peaches and Cream Pull Apart Bread is a delightful and indulgent treat that combines the flavors of juicy peaches, creamy glaze, and sweet cinnamon sugar in a soft, pull-apart bread loaf.

FOR BREAD
- 20 Rhodes Dinner Rolls
- 1/2 Cup Butter, Melted
- 3/4 Cup Granulated Sugar
- 1 tsp Cinnamon
- 21 oz Peach Fruit Filling
FOR GLAZE
- 4 oz Cream Cheese, Softened
- 1 Cup Powdered Sugar
- 1 tsp Pure Vanilla Extract
- 2–3 TBSP Milk
- FOR BREAD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Place 20 frozen Rhodes rolls on parchment and lightly cover with plastic wrap. Thaw for 2 hours. Melt butter and let it cool. Lightly spray a loaf pan. Mix sugar and cinnamon. Press two rolls flat, dip in butter and sugar, place peach slice, sandwich with another roll. Set upright in loaf pan, repeat for second row. Bake at 375°F for 35-40 minutes. Let cool for 15 minutes.
- FOR GLAZE Whip c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la until smooth. Thin with milk. Drizzle over the bread with a fork or pipe in a zig-zag pattern.
